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
48451875 820288443 37835085672
404496787 3088060155
404496787 3088060155
6208 0164227 3180739 9708432138 04
All about undefined
Interested in learning more?
404496787 3088060155
6208 0164227 3180739 9708432138 04
See more
1732 60611676 24768
19909 089 2897294121
See more
568 918
7036 567475 314 9596
See more